Verdict

A case can be made for plenty of these but it may pay to take a chance on HEART OVER HEAD who chased home a now useful sort on bumper debut and looks to have be campaigned with handicaps over this sort of trip in mind. He's narrowly preferred to fellow handicap debutant Nazare, while Bitsnbuckles could have say if ready to roll on return. Walk In The Valley is by no means a back number stepping back up in trip for a capable yard.

Horse Racing Basic Terms

Main Track Only

A horse entered for main track only (MTO) is one hoping the weather forecast or track conditions will move the race off the turf course and onto the main track. They are scratched the morning of the race if the conditions stay dry.

Bleeder

A horse that bleeds due to a ruptured blood vessel during a race or workout. The medication Lasix can fix this problem.

Overlay

A horse going off at higher odds than his recent efforts show that he deserves.
